What Skiers Say About Les 2 Alpes
Les 2 Alpes attracts a mixed crowd of beginners through to advanced skiers and snowboarders, with families and groups of friends in their twenties being common. The high altitude consistently delivers good snow conditions, and the lift system—particularly the new Jandri lift—receives widespread praise for minimal queuing. Reviewers frequently mention the lively après-ski scene at Pano Bar and Umbrella Bar, though opinions on the skiing area size vary, with some feeling the advertised piste kilometres overstate the actual terrain. The lower slopes, particularly the narrow runs back to the village at the end of the day, are repeatedly criticised for being icy, overcrowded, and challenging. Most visitors appreciate the range of restaurants and bars in the town, though some note limited and expensive on-mountain dining options.

There is an abundance of blue runs which are reliably open with changing conditions. Allowing the opportunity to ski from 3600m to 1600m continuous. However, the offer of the few greens and reds are less reliable. The slopes are shaped around large off piste areas which open up the resort, especially connecting certain areas of the park together. The slopes also offer a snowpack for freestylers, several bars and food, plenty of lift access across the park and some viewing points to enjoy on bluebird days.
The resort is well connected to neighbouring villages but some lifts and also a bus shuttle service which drops off at lift access points. In the main resort you can find an abundance of ski shops for rentals or those last minute items. There are many places to eat with La Sherpa, Buzz and Pizza Chalet being hot spots to frequent. If a pub crawl is your thing, youre in for a treat with 31 options, all a variety of offerings.

Great for skiing for a much longer season as the mountain has a glacier under the snow to keep cool up until June. I visited in April last year and the snow was perfect so good that I am going again in April 2025. Less people on the slope but still great snow.
